A woman in Arizona woke up one night and suddenly realized she had changed completely to an English accent. The strange thing is, she lived her whole life only in America.

This woman is called Michelle Myers. In 2015, after a night of headaches, she woke up and possessed a tone like a true British. And this English intonation still follows her for 2 years.

Ms. Myers recalled that she had previously had her voice changed to Irish and Australian accents, but those times only lasted about a week.

She was diagnosed with foreign accent syndrome (FAS), a syndrome that caused the patient to suddenly change her voice into a completely different country voice.

This condition is caused by two main causes: stroke and brain damage.

In addition, she was diagnosed with Ehlers-Danlos syndrome. This syndrome affects connective tissue in the body, leading to loose joints, stretching pores, easy bruising, and especially increasing the risk of blood vessel rupture.

Foreign speech syndrome is an extremely rare syndrome. Over the past century, the world literature has only recorded about 60 cases of the disease.

In 2010, there was a woman living in Virgina who suddenly had a Russian accent after a head injury due to falling stairs. Another woman living in Ontario, Canada has changed her voice to a Maritime Atlantic accent, after a stroke.
